Understanding Finance Infrastructure Build

At its core, finance infrastructure build is about creating the backbone that supports financial operations. It encompasses everything from the physical and technological frameworks to the regulatory and policy structures that govern financial interactions. In essence, it's the collective infrastructure that enables banks, financial institutions, and individuals to conduct transactions securely, efficiently, and seamlessly.

The Future Landscape

As we look to the future, the finance infrastructure build will continue to evolve, driven by technological advancements, regulatory changes, and customer expectations. The following trends are likely to shape the future landscape:

1. Decentralized Finance (DeFi): DeFi is an emerging trend that aims to recreate traditional financial systems using blockchain technology. It promises to democratize access to financial services, eliminate intermediaries, and offer greater transparency.

2. Central Bank Digital Currencies (CBDCs): CBDCs are digital currencies issued by central banks. They aim to combine the benefits of digital currencies with the stability and trust associated with central banking. The introduction of CBDCs could transform how we think about money and banking.

3. AI-Driven Financial Services: AI will continue to play a pivotal role in financial services, from predictive analytics to automated trading. The integration of AI with other technologies like blockchain will lead to more sophisticated and efficient financial systems.

4. Enhanced Cybersecurity: As cyber threats become more sophisticated, the focus on cybersecurity will intensify. Future finance infrastructure will need to incorporate advanced security measures to protect against these threats.

5. Sustainable Finance: Sustainability is becoming a critical aspect of finance infrastructure build. Institutions are increasingly focusing on sustainable practices, integrating ESG (Environmental, Social, and Governance) criteria into their operations.

Case Studies of Successful Implementations

To understand the real-world impact of the finance infrastructure build, let’s look at some notable case studies:

1. Santander’s Open Bank: Santander’s Open Bank is a pioneering example of how traditional banks are adapting to the fintech revolution. By creating an open banking platform, Santander has enabled third-party developers to create innovative financial services, enhancing customer engagement and driving competition within the banking sector.

2. Ripple’s Blockchain for Cross-Border Payments: Ripple has made significant strides in the finance infrastructure build by developing a blockchain-based platform for cross-border payments. Their solution, known as RippleNet, offers faster, more secure, and cheaper international money transfers, significantly benefiting businesses and consumers alike.

3. IBM’s Blockchain for Supply Chain Management: IBM has implemented blockchain technology to enhance supply chain management. By creating a secure and transparent ledger for supply chain transactions, IBM has improved efficiency, reduced fraud, and enhanced trust among supply chain participants.

Understanding ZK Proof and Stablecoins

At its core, ZK Proof leverages zero-knowledge proofs (ZKPs) to offer a high level of security and privacy in blockchain transactions. Zero-knowledge proofs are cryptographic protocols that allow one party (the prover) to prove to another party (the verifier) that a certain statement is true, without conveying any additional information apart from the fact that the statement is indeed true. This means that sensitive financial data remains confidential, while the transaction's legitimacy is verified.

Stablecoins, on the other hand, are a type of cryptocurrency pegged to the value of a traditional asset, like the US dollar. The primary goal of stablecoins is to provide the stability of fiat currency while benefiting from the advantages of blockchain technology. They are particularly useful in reducing the volatility often associated with other cryptocurrencies.
